This case, Cr.No.161 of 2016 is registered for alleged offences under Section 147, 294(b), 324 and 506(ii) of Indian Penal Code, 1860. The parties have moved on and have no objection to the case being disposed of on compromise. Due to the unique manner in which this designated bench conducts hybrid hearings, the filing of written affidavits or terms of compromise is dispensed with. Considering the factual matrix, the context in which the conflict arose, the background of the parties, and their present Page No.1 of 3
position, this is an appropriate case for the exercise of jurisdiction under Section 482 of the Code of Criminal Procedure as per Gian Singh -Vs State of Punjab & another, (2012 10 SCC 303).
2. Accordingly, the case in C.C.No.224 of 2019 on the file of the District Munsif Cum Judicial Magistrate Court, Senthurai Taluk, Ariyalur shall stands quashed and this Suo Motu Transfer Case stands allowed. 25.08.2025 nsl electronically alone. The Trial Court shall take note of the order and accordingly classify the case pending before them as allowed / dismissed / disposed of, etc, and while doing so, consider any applications such as disposal of properties, etc., and pass appropriate orders, as may be necessary. Further, the Court below is directed to dispatch the copy of this order to all concerned. Page No.2 of 3
